“…Piemonti (11) found that the expression of CD86 was inhibited in the presence of 1,25(OH) 2 D 3 , but that the expression of CD80 was not signi®cantly affected. This is in contrast to data from Berer (12), who found that CD86 expression was unaffected by 1,25(OH) 2 D 3 , whereas upregulation of CD80 was prevented. Immature DCs can be further differentiated into mature DCs in vitro by culturing them with lipopolysaccharide, TNF-a, IL-1 or CD40-ligand (13,14).…”

“…This may explain in part the relative resistance of immature DCs as compared with monocyte precursors to the inhibitory effects of the ligand. Although immature DCs still retain some sensitivity to 1␣25(OH) 2 D 3 (5,6,44), mature DCs are almost completely resistant to its inhibitory effects (44) despite similar expression of VDR. Thus, other factors, including expression of partner receptors/coactivators or the integrity of downstream signaling pathways, are likely to contribute to this resistance.…”

“…1,25(OH) 2 D 3 also regulates antigen-presenting cells such as macrophages and dendritic cells. It inhibits dendritic cell differentiation from peripheral blood monocytes and suppresses the production of IL-12, a cytokine crucial for the development of Th1 cells (1,7,33,34). Consistent with its anti-inflammatory role, 1,25(OH) 2 D 3 downregulates the expression of many other proinflammatory cytokines such as IL-1, IL-6, IL-8, and TNF-␣ in a variety of cell types (9,12).…”
